Firm Overview

Northwood Investors is a privately-held real estate investment advisor that was founded in 2006 by John Kukral, the former President and CEO of Blackstone Real Estate Advisors. Northwood employs a fundamental, value-driven investment strategy with a longer-term outlook. Northwood invests alongside institutional and private clients in a broad range of real estate and real estate-related investment opportunities globally, with approximately $7 billion of assets under management. The Northwood team has deep experience in sourcing, executing and managing real estate transactions worldwide, ranging from office buildings and shopping centers to hotels and residential investments.

Northwood has office locations in the US in Denver (headquarters), New York, Dallas, Los Angeles and Charlotte. The firm also has employees who work for vertically integrated platforms, such as Retail and Hospitality, in Florida, North and South Carolina, California, and Texas. Additionally, the firm has professional teams located in the United Kingdom, Luxembourg, Paris, Singapore and Amsterdam.

Position Overview

The Director of Accounting will work at the Denver Home office and manage staff accountants.  The Director of accounting will work closely with and ensure timely communication with the property accounting teams.  In addition to the property accounting teams, this position will work directly with the VP of Finance to ensure all property level accounting needs are met.  The Director of Accounting will actively monitor our company operations and make recommendations to executive management about enhancing business processes and procedures.  The successful candidate will also work with the management team to identify opportunities to help increase productivity and support property operations with implementing proposed process changes. 

Responsibilities

  • Set priorities for direct reports and ensure support to property accounting teams
  • Identify the optimal / most efficient workflow and duties for direct reports in support of the home office and hotel property accounting teams
  • People development – Help train, mentor and lead direct reports
  • Review / oversee daily audit and analysis of overnight revenue processing
  • Oversee daily cash management activities
  • Oversee Accounts Payable processing
  • Manage the generation and review of journal entries to ensure compliance with GAAP and company policies for assigned areas, and adjust as needed
  • Analyze records of financial transactions to determine accuracy and completeness of journal entries
  • Review and approve general ledgers and financial statements prior to final month end closing
  • Utilize analytical skills to compile data, research and analyze accounting and financial information
  • Review, identify, research and resolve monthly variances in balance sheet and income statement accounts compared to budget utilizing independent judgement
  • Prepare summary financial reports and ad hoc financial analysis
  • Design or revise reports, forms, tools and procedures to improve efficiency and accuracy
  • Customer service – Ensure daily interaction with property teams is occurring as to understand their needs, research their inquiries, support their requests, and help them to resolve issues.
  • Preparation / review of month end reconciliations and the final monthly closing
  • Preparation / review of monthly financial statement compilation
  • Preparation / review of monthly balance sheet and income statement account reconciliations to include design, preparation and maintenance of any necessary supporting documentation
  • Other duties as assigned.
